Threats Associated With LASIK



Many individuals undergoing LASIK surgery are mainly concerned regarding potential threats connected with the treatment. While LASIK is a safe and efficient treatment for vision Correction, like any operation, it does feature some dangers.

One of the most typical risks connected with LASIK consist of completely dry eyes, glow, halos, and difficulty driving at evening in the immediate postoperative period. These signs are usually short-term and boost as the eyes heal.

In rare situations, more major problems such as infection, corneal flap issues, and vision loss can happen, but the likelihood of these problems is extremely reduced when the surgical treatment is done by a competent and skilled eye doctor. It is very important to review these risks with your physician during the assessment to ensure you have a clear understanding of what to expect.

Eligibility Misconceptions



Some individuals incorrectly think that just individuals with serious vision problems are eligible for LASIK surgical procedure. Nevertheless, this is a common mistaken belief. While LASIK is often connected with dealing with high degrees of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ism, individuals with milder vision issues can likewise be eligible candidates. Actually, innovations in LASIK technology have actually broadened the range of treatable prescriptions, permitting even more individuals to take advantage of the procedure.

LASIK qualification is figured out with an extensive eye exam by a qualified ophthalmologist. Factors such as corneal thickness, eye health and wellness, and general medical history play a critical role in analyzing a person's viability for the surgical treatment.
